FrontView (FVR) earnings results highlight valuation concerns, trading momentum, and investor sentiment with expert investment analysis and trading insights. FrontView REIT Inc. (FVR)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$0.02, handily beating the consensus estimate of -$0.0269—a surprise of 174.35%. Revenue figures were not disclosed for the period. Following the announcement, the stock moved up 0.56%, reflecting investor optimism around the unexpected profitability.

FrontView REIT’s Q1 2026 performance demonstrated a notable turn from the anticipated loss, with actual EPS reaching positive territory. While the company did not provide specific revenue or segment-level data, the earnings beat may be attributed to effective cost management, favorable lease terms, or higher-than-expected occupancy across its portfolio. As a real estate investment trust, FrontView’s income typically depends on rental revenues and property expenses; the swing from a negative estimate to a positive result suggests that operational efficiencies or non-recurring gains may have contributed. Without detailed segment disclosure, investors can infer that the core property operations performed well during the quarter. The lack of revenue data, however, leaves some uncertainty about the underlying top-line strength and whether the beat was driven by sustainable operating income or one-time items. Further clarity from management would be valuable to assess the durability of this earnings trajectory. FrontView REIT did not issue forward guidance in its Q1 2026 release, leaving the market to interpret the results without an explicit outlook. The company’s strategic priorities may include maintaining disciplined capital allocation, optimizing lease structures, and selectively expanding its property portfolio. The REIT sector continues to face headwinds from elevated interest rates, which raise financing costs and cap rate expectations, potentially pressuring net asset values. Additionally, shifts in commercial real estate demand—particularly in office and retail segments—could affect occupancy and rental growth. FrontView’s ability to sustain positive earnings will likely depend on its lease renewal rates, tenant credit quality, and expense control. The absence of guidance suggests management may prefer to monitor economic conditions before committing to a forecast. Investors should watch for any subsequent commentary or filings that might clarify the company’s expectations for the remainder of 2026. The market’s muted positive reaction—a 0.56% stock move—indicates that while the earnings beat was significant, it may have been overshadowed by the lack of revenue disclosure and guidance. Analysts have likely taken note of the large EPS surprise, but many will await more granular data before adjusting their models. The stock’s modest rise suggests that the beat was somewhat anticipated or that concerns about data transparency tempered enthusiasm. Looking ahead, key watchpoints include the company’s next quarterly report for comparable figures, any property acquisitions or dispositions, and broader REIT sector trends such as interest rate movements. Investors should also monitor the company’s funds from operations (FFO) metrics, which are commonly used to evaluate REIT performance.
